Margins on the Kestrel series slipped two points due to resin costs; the Wren line held steady. We will rebaseline standard costs by the 20th and update the contribution model accordingly. Please reconcile plant-level variances before the review session and flag any allocations that look off. Output feeds directly into next year's pricing assumptions, so accuracy matters more than speed here. Strategic context appears below.

board note of bajop-yaweg: The western region missed its Pelys quota by 58.0 percent last quarter. Pelysek Foods plans to raise the Belius list price by 44.0 percent in July. The steering committee signed off on a budget of $133.8 million for Project Pelax. The renewal with Zoraelix Systems closes at $61.9 million a year, 12.7 percent above the last contract.

**Q: The Quillstack autoscaler stopped scaling on queue depth. Now what?**

A: Check the scaler pod first. If it's crash-looping, restart it. If metrics are flat, the broker connection likely dropped — cycle it. Escalate only if both fail. Unlocking the scaler's sealed config requires manual recovery; do not guess values. Log every attempt in the incident channel. When prompted by the recovery tool, enter the passphrase shown immediately below.

unlock words, tagaf-hahif: ralwyn-lammir-rusax-sormir

### Changed defaults — sqlwarden 3.0 (Fernhollow tooling)

The default lint profile for SQL files is now strict. Rules forbidding string-concatenated literals, unparameterized predicates, and GRANT statements outside migration directories are enabled by default rather than opt-in. CI fails on any violation; there is no warn-only tier anymore. Suppressions require an inline justification comment and are reported in the audit summary. These defaults are driven by the following configuration values.

config for tafof-tawig:
[casox]
port = 5000
region = south-4
host = casox.paliqlabs.internal
timeout_ms = 2000
retries = 8